Recreation - the NEW Season

YOUNG. COLOURFUL. FEMALE.

Fantastic young musicians from Austria are leaving their mark on our new season. Oboist Katharina Kratochwil plays Mozart’s Oboe Concerto, double bass player Dominik Wagner the second Bottesini concerto. Moldovan violinist Alexandra Tirsu also studied in Vienna. Conductors Tobias Wögerer and Ingmar Beck come to us from Linz, cellist Ursina Braun and conductor Lena-Lisa Wüstendörfer from Switzerland. Recreation’s orchestral concerts are creating a stage for the younger generation, also and especially for women on the podium.

This season’s programmes are seductive, sporty and elegant: our chief conductor Mei-Ann Chen dedicates one evening to the immortal opera character Carmen, another to the symphonic dances of Jennifer Higdon and Sergei Rachmaninov. Russian Galina Ustvolskaya called her orchestral suite “Sport” – a fitting answer to Tchaikovsky’s powerful Fifth in Italian-Turkish conductor Nil Venditti’s programme. Rachel Portman is the only woman to have received the Oscar for Best Original Score. Her violin concerto on the four elements, which will be performed at the season finale, is worthy of a film. Or to put it in a nutshell: “Recreation of the mind” is guaranteed at all concerts!
